Wii Chiiwaakanak Learning Centre

The Wii Chiiwaakanak Learning Centre is open 5 days a week. Providing free and open access to the RBC Community Learning Commons (a computer lab with staff on-site to assist with anything from resume building and connections to other local resources), and an Indigenous-designed classroom accessible to community partners. The centre offers an after school science and homework club, women’s self-defense courses, STEAM camps in the summer and over spring break, partnership between inner-city schools to run science kids on campus programming and several after school Indigenous language and cultural programs.
